- The distance between Nuuk/ Godthåb, Greenland and Rio Gallegos, Argentina is approximately 12,964 km or 8,056 mi.
- To reach Nuuk/ Godthåb in this distance one would set out from Rio Gallegos bearing 8.4°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Nuuk/ Godthåb bearing 12.1° or NNE .
- Nuuk/ Godthåb has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Rio Gallegos has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Nuuk/ Godthåb is in or near the subpolar rain tundra biome whereas Rio Gallegos is in or near the cool temperate desert scrub biome.
- The average temperature is 9.2 °C (16.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2 °C (3.6°F) more in Nuuk/ Godthåb.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 513.8 mm (20.2 in) more which is equivalent to 513.8 l/m² (12.61 US gal/ft²) or 5,138,000 l/ha (549,286 US gal/ac) more. About 3 1/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.8° lower in Nuuk/ Godthåb than in Rio Gallegos.
- Relative humidity levels are 15.2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 5.5°C (10°F) lower.
